The smallest number which can be divided by both 4 and 5 without a remainder is 20. This is also known as the Least Common Multiple (LCM).
The lowest common factor (the smallest positive whole number which divides into all the numbers without any remainder) of 3, 4, 16 is 1, as it is for any set of numbers. The highest common factor (the largest positive whole number which divides into all the numbers without any remainder) is also 1. The lowest common multiple ((the smallest positive whole number into which divide all the numbers without any remainder, ie the smallest positive whole number which is a multiple of all the numbers) is 48.

When a number can be divided by another number without leaving a remainder, it is called divisible. For example, 10 is divisible by 2 because when we divide 10 by 2, there is no remainder.

The least common multiple, or LCM, is the smallest positive integer that all the members of a given set of numbers will divide into evenly with no remainder.
